BTS' Suga is reportedly slated to release his first very own solo mixtape.

According to some news outlets, BTS' rapper Suga will be releasing his mixtape in the beginning of August. Since his debut as a member of the famous boy group BTS, many fans are always been anticipated and waited so long for his solo mixtape and now it's officially coming out!

This is his first solo mixtape after his debut as BTS. His mixtape will be a masterpiece for Suga will be able to showcase his talents as a rapper writing his own songs. 

Mixtapes are usually made in the hip-hop industry and are distributed for free. Since this isn't an official release, there's no need for deliberation or filtering, allowing fans to hear artists' sincere stories.

Suga has recorded his bold and hard-hitting stories for this mixtape, and will give off a new charm that is different from when he is promoting as a BTS member. This will surely give a glimpse of Suga's superb musical talents.

He has reportedly finished recording the mixtape and is currently filming his music video that will be released ahead of his mixtape.

Suga was also spotted filming his MV. A fan shared a shot of the filming site and shared it on SNS.

BTS's Rap Monster has released his own mixtape before and was loved by fans, great feedback was mounting too!
